Marlin Becker

Marlin Vaughn Becker, 56, of Lindsborg and formerly of McPherson, passed away Friday, December 2, 2011, at Via Christi/St. Francis Regional Medical Center in Wichita. He was a machinist at American Maplan in McPherson, working there for over 23 years.

He was born October 17, 1955, in McPherson, Kansas, the son of Theodore Tobias and Evelyn Jenny (Moulds) Becker. He attended the local schools and graduated from McPherson High School in 1973.

Survivors include: a son, Travis Becker of Augusta, Kansas; a daughter, Teri Chrislip (Keith) of Olathe, KS; two brothers, Mike Becker (Anita) of Poquoson, VA and Mitchell Becker (Suzanne) of Moundridge, KS; a sister, Cheryl Brandsted (John) of McPherson, KS; two grandchildren, Ashlynn Paige Becker and Finley Chrislip.

He was preceded in death by his parents, Ted and Evelyn.

The funeral service will be at 10:00 AM, Saturday, December 10, at Stockham Family Funeral Home. Burial will be in the Halstead Cemetery. Visitation will be from 3:00 to 8:00 PM Friday at Stockham Family Funeral Home with the family receiving friends from 6:00 to 8:00 PM.
